# Approvals: Brightledger Loyalty-Points Ledger

All manual adjustments to the Brightledger points ledger require a two-stage approval: a shift approver confirms the correction amount, then the ledger steward signs off before the nightly posting run. On-call engineers must not apply hotfix adjustments directly; file an adjustment request and page the steward if the posting window is at risk. Approval authority for emergency overrides rests with the person named below.

account owner for bawip-tahag: Raleth Quenok

**Artifact signing — hot-reload configs**

Glimmerd supports hot-reloading of its runtime configuration, but reloaded config bundles must be signed or the daemon rejects them and keeps the previous version. Maintainers produce bundles with `glimctl pack`, then sign with `glimctl sign` before pushing to the config channel. Unsigned bundles are logged and dropped silently, which has confused people before — check the audit log first. Signing for the production channel uses the key below.

rollout seal: bky9_PeXH1fTLY

Subject: Handoff — leaked FD investigation on Quillgate

Team,

As of this rotation, responsibility for the leaked-file-descriptor hunt on the Quillgate ingest fleet is changing hands. Please review the lsof snapshots collected nightly, compare against the baseline from the Marrowbrook staging cluster, and note any descriptor counts climbing past 8,000 per worker. Escalate only if growth persists across two restarts. The engineer now owning this investigation, and your first point of contact, is named below.

account owner for kafop-haweg: Pelax Gilael Istir